Forest Supervisor

Kelly Lawrence has served as Forest Supervisor on the Olympic National Forest since March 2020.

Originally from Portland, OR, she began her career in federal service as an environmental education volunteer with the Peace Corps in Kazakhstan. Lawrence has over 20 years with the Forest Service in research, partnerships, planning and leadership roles. Prior to joining the Olympic she was the District Ranger on the Naches Ranger District.

Deputy Forest Supervisor

Christina Milos joined the Olympic National Forest as Deputy Forest Supervisor in September 2025.

Milos joins the forest after most recently serving as acting Director for the U.S. Forest Service’s Planning Service Center. In her 9-year career with the agency, she has had extensive experience in leadership, program management, and collaboration. She began her career with a decade of international experience in natural resource management and community engagement with non-profit and international organizations.
